From: laurentiu.tudor@nxp.com (laurentiu.tudor at nxp.com)
To: linux-arm-kernel@lists.infradead.org
Subject: [PATCH v2 00/15] staging: fsl-mc: clean up header files
Date: Tue, 27 Jun 2017 17:41:20 +0300 [thread overview]
Message-ID: <20170627144135.15599-1-laurentiu.tudor@nxp.com> (raw)
From: Laurentiu Tudor <laurentiu.tudor@nxp.com>
This patch series contain mainly clean-ups of the mc-bus header files
with the final goal of reorganizing them in just 2 files: a public
and a private one, as per GregKH suggestion [1].
Here's a summary of the header reorganizing:
- existing mc.h used as public header (contained most of the public API)
- existing fsl-mc-private.h used for private header
- mc-bus.h merged both in public and private header
- mc-sys.h and mc-cmd.h merged in public header
- dprc.h made private
- dpmng.h deleted
[1] https://patchwork.kernel.org/patch/9775683/
version 2 changes
- fix compilation issue
- reordered a comparison, be consistent when checking strcmp() return
(Joe Perches, first two patches)
Laurentiu Tudor (15):
staging: fsl-mc: move comparison before strcmp() call
staging: fsl-mc: be consistent when checking strcmp() return
staging: fsl-mc: drop useless #includes
staging: fsl-mc: decouple the mc-bus public headers from dprc.h
staging: fsl-mc: delete duplicated function prototypes
staging: fsl-mc: delete prototype of unimplemented function
staging: fsl-mc: turn several exported functions static
staging: fsl-mc: move irq domain creation prototype to public header
staging: fsl-mc: move couple of definitions to public header
staging: fsl-mc: move rest of mc-bus.h to private header
staging: fsl-mc: remove dpmng API files
staging: fsl-mc: fix a few implicit includes
staging: fsl-mc: move mc-sys.h contents in the public header
staging: fsl-mc: move mc-cmd.h contents in the public header
staging: fsl-mc: make dprc.h header private
drivers/staging/fsl-dpaa2/ethernet/dpaa2-eth.c | 1 -
drivers/staging/fsl-dpaa2/ethernet/dpni.c | 3 +-
drivers/staging/fsl-mc/bus/Makefile | 1 -
drivers/staging/fsl-mc/bus/dpbp.c | 4 +-
drivers/staging/fsl-mc/bus/dpcon.c | 4 +-
drivers/staging/fsl-mc/bus/dpio/dpio.c | 4 +-
drivers/staging/fsl-mc/bus/dpmcp.c | 4 +-
drivers/staging/fsl-mc/bus/dpmng.c | 74 --------
drivers/staging/fsl-mc/bus/dprc-driver.c | 54 +++---
drivers/staging/fsl-mc/bus/dprc.c | 8 +-
drivers/staging/fsl-mc/{include => bus}/dprc.h | 46 +----
drivers/staging/fsl-mc/bus/fsl-mc-allocator.c | 11 +-
drivers/staging/fsl-mc/bus/fsl-mc-bus.c | 71 +++++--
drivers/staging/fsl-mc/bus/fsl-mc-msi.c | 2 -
drivers/staging/fsl-mc/bus/fsl-mc-private.h | 64 ++++++-
.../staging/fsl-mc/bus/irq-gic-v3-its-fsl-mc-msi.c | 1 -
drivers/staging/fsl-mc/bus/mc-io.c | 3 +-
drivers/staging/fsl-mc/bus/mc-sys.c | 2 -
drivers/staging/fsl-mc/include/dpmng.h | 67 -------
drivers/staging/fsl-mc/include/mc-bus.h | 111 -----------
drivers/staging/fsl-mc/include/mc-cmd.h | 130 -------------
drivers/staging/fsl-mc/include/mc-sys.h | 98 ----------
drivers/staging/fsl-mc/include/mc.h | 204 ++++++++++++++++++++-
23 files changed, 371 insertions(+), 596 deletions(-)
delete mode 100644 drivers/staging/fsl-mc/bus/dpmng.c
rename drivers/staging/fsl-mc/{include => bus}/dprc.h (84%)
delete mode 100644 drivers/staging/fsl-mc/include/dpmng.h
delete mode 100644 drivers/staging/fsl-mc/include/mc-bus.h
delete mode 100644 drivers/staging/fsl-mc/include/mc-cmd.h
delete mode 100644 drivers/staging/fsl-mc/include/mc-sys.h
--
2.9.4
next reply other threads:[~2017-06-27 14:41 UTC|newest]
Thread overview: 19+ messages / expand[flat|nested] mbox.gz Atom feed top
2017-06-27 14:41 laurentiu.tudor at nxp.com [this message]
2017-06-27 14:41 ` [PATCH v2 01/15] staging: fsl-mc: move comparison before strcmp() call la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 02/15] staging: fsl-mc: be consistent when checking strcmp() return la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 03/15] staging: fsl-mc: drop useless #includes la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 04/15] staging: fsl-mc: decouple the mc-bus public headers from dprc.h la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 05/15] staging: fsl-mc: delete duplicated function prototypes la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 06/15] staging: fsl-mc: delete prototype of unimplemented function la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 07/15] staging: fsl-mc: turn several exported functions static la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 08/15] staging: fsl-mc: move irq domain creation prototype to public header la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 09/15] staging: fsl-mc: move couple of definitions " la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 10/15] staging: fsl-mc: move rest of mc-bus.h to private header la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 11/15] staging: fsl-mc: remove dpmng API files la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 12/15] staging: fsl-mc: fix a few implicit includes la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 13/15] staging: fsl-mc: move mc-sys.h contents in the public header la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 14/15] staging: fsl-mc: move mc-cmd.h " laurentiu.tudor at nxp.com
2017-06-27 14:41 ` [PATCH v2 15/15] staging: fsl-mc: make dprc.h header private laurentiu.tudor at nxp.com
2017-06-27 15:33 ` [PATCH v2 00/15] staging: fsl-mc: clean up header files Arnd Bergmann
2017-06-27 16:00 ` gregkh
2017-06-27 20:21 ` Arnd Bergmann
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20170627144135.15599-1-laurentiu.tudor@nxp.com \
--to=laurentiu.tudor@nxp.com \
--cc=linux-arm-kernel@lists.infradead.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).